I use the Gore Alp X waterproof shorts and today I wore them with knee pads. Mind you they are knee-length which I reckon is actually better than 3/4 cos they won't get caught up.
The Alp X are, funnily enough, made of Goretex Paclite so very unobtrusive and you don't notice you are wearing them. However, I don't reckon they would be much good over baggies.

I use the Attacks - yes, they will fit over pads. Mine are sized medium for a 33ish inch waist, and they only just go small enough, so be careful on sizing!
yep, they are comfy worn over liner shorts
